Turkish production and distribution company Inter Medya continues to expand the reach of one of its most promising daily drama series, “The Girl of the Green Valley,” and has now inked deals in the US Hispanic market, Puerto Rico, Peru, and Panama. The show has been previously licensed to various countries such as Chile, Bolivia, Uruguay, Spain, Hungary, and Israel.

Last month, “The Girl of the Green Valley” made its international premiere on Wapa TV in Puerto Rico with the title “Melissa.” According to a Nielsen poll, the first episode, which aired from 5:30 PM to 7:00 PM, set a rating record against major local channels and managed to dominate its entire demographic.

Starred by worldwide famous Beren Gökyıldız, “The Girl of the Green Valley” is inspired from the beloved book “Ann of Green Gables,” written by Lucy Maud Montgomery. Produced by Yesil Yapim, this show follows a girl who is left without a mother and father when she was a baby. No one knows the truth about what happened to her family.
